8-K: Armata Pharmaceuticals Appoints New CFO, Adjusts Executive Contracts

Sentiment:

Current Report (8-K)


Armata Pharmaceuticals announced the promotion of David House to Chief Financial Officer and updated employment terms for Pierre Kyme, effective July 17, 2026.

Summary

  • David House has been promoted to Chief Financial Officer (CFO) of Armata Pharmaceuticals, Inc., effective July 17, 2026.
  • House previously served as Senior Vice President, Finance and principal financial officer since August 2024.
  • His new role includes an annual base salary of $371,315.
  • He is eligible for a target annual bonus of 50% of his base salary.
  • He is also eligible for annual equity awards with a current intended grant date fair value of approximately $300,000, commencing in 2026.
  • The company also amended Pierre Kyme's employment agreement to align the definition of 'change in control' with that of other senior executives.
  • The amendment to Kyme's agreement, dated June 1, 2024, was effective July 17, 2026.

Risks

  • Potential for involuntary termination without Cause or resignation for Good Reason for David House, which would trigger 12 months of base salary severance.
  • Vesting acceleration of equity awards for David House if an involuntary termination occurs within one month prior to or 12 months following a Change in Control.
  • Potential for Pierre Kyme's equity awards to accelerate if an involuntary termination occurs within one month prior to or 12 months following a Change in Control.
